Edward "Ed" Ronald Joseph Lane, of Muskegon, MI, died of cancer Friday, 23 September 2022 at the Harbor Hospice Poppen House in Muskegon. He was 65 years old.

Ed was born on August 25, 1957 in Chicago, Illinois, the son of Ann-Marie and Ronald Lane. After a childhood marked by misadventure, Ed enlisted in the United States Army straight out of high school in 1976 and served his enlistment in Nuremberg, Germany as a Lance missile system crewmember. Shortly after his return to the US, Ed met Diane Haveman, of Rapid City, SD, and they married in Chicago in 1982. Their first child, Christine, was born that same year.

The next year, the Lanes moved to Racine, WI, where they had two more children: Derek, born in 1985, and Samantha, born in 1986. In 1988, the family moved again, back to Diane's hometown of Rapid City, where Ed worked for Computer Land and the Rapid City Journal before settling in at RESPEC Engineering as a computer programmer, a position he held until his retirement in 2021. His success at RESPEC later allowed him to bring Christine's husband Frank in under his wing as assistant and pupil, and the two worked closely together for many years. In 2019, Ed and Diane divorced, prompting him to leave South Dakota, at first temporarily to Florida, and then to Muskegon, to live with his partner, Colette Palazzola.

While at times irascible and temperamental, Ed was fiercely loyal to and protective of his family, whether they wanted him to be or not. He was generous with his money, willing to help family in need, tipping outrageously, and being a great patron of street musicians.

Ed Lane is survived by his sisters, Diane Denz, Linda Mager, and Debra Simmons; his children, Christine Bakkevik, Derek Lane, and Samantha Truelsen; his grandson, Audun Bakkevik; and his significant other. Collette Palazzola.
